Mama Pamba - Celebrating the many shapes, sizes, and ages of beauty.
Mama Pamba means "Mother Cotton" in the local dialect.
What is Mama Pamba?
Mama Pamba is a 100% fair-trade fashion label based in Uganda.
Mama Pamba works with rurally poor Ugandan women and empower them to be masters of their own destiny.
Mama Pamba is the third fair-trade project that Meaningful Volunteer has set up.

Volunteers in the Ugandan program will be accommodated in the guest house in the parish of Buyaya in the district of Sironko. The guest house contains a boys' room, a girls' room, a room for Meaningful Volunteer staff, a lounge, a store room for food, a garage, and an inside shower room. The toilets are outside and are of the long-drop variety.
* The guest house has no electricity. A generator is provided
* Internet is available in the guest house via a small USB device that connects to a computer.
* Three meals a day are prepared for the volunteers.

Meaningful Volunteer is committed to be as open and honest as we can with all our volunteers. This extends from detailed explanations of free resources for all our projects, right down to the day-to-day costs of running the organization.
This extends to the fees that we charge for our volunteer placements. Our fees are broken down item-by-item. Fees also differ depending on whether it is the first or subsequent months of your placement.
Entebbe Airport Pickup - USD 100.00
We will arrange an airport pickup for you. All your costs to get to the placement location is covered by us.
Mama Pamba Donation - USD 250.00
All of our volunteer fees have a donation component built into them. This helps us cover the costs of the project.
For Mama Pamba, your donation goes towards sewing machines and sewing supplies
Ugandan Accommodation - USD 250.00
All our Ugandan volunteers stay at the guesthouse in Buyaya.
The accommodation portion of your fee covers your board as well as 3 meals a day prepared by our staff.
Ugandan Admin - USD 200.00
Meaningful Volunteer is a 100% non-profit organization. Any profits we do make are reinvested back into the communities we work in.
Much of our admin money goes towards keeping the organization running on a day-to-day basis.
A large portion of the money goes to keep out wonderful local staff employed. Meaningful Volunteer is committed to empowering local people in local communities.
Uganda Training - USD 50.00
Volunteers will be given full training upon arrival at the guest house in Buyaya
You will be taken through our Volunteer Manual
You will also be shown around the site and sounds of Buyaya.
* Note also that there is a USD 100 application fee that applies to all projects.

Meaningfulness: Every project that Meaningful Volunteer undertakes must be meaningful. Accurate records must be kept to ensure that a project continues to be meaningful. Financial: Meaningful Volunteer is first and foremost an organization that enables volunteers to have a meaningful impact on developing communities. It is not a charity and will not be run as such. MeaningfulVolunteer will be run like a for-profit business. However, any profits that Meaningful Volunteer does make will be reinvested back into the communities it is trying to help in the forms of educational supplies, medical supplies and so on. Meaningful Volunteer finances will be 100% transparent. All financial statements and a breakdown of volunteer fees will be available on-line. Local Investment: Meaningful Volunteer believes that people in developing countries are an untapped goldmine of talent! As a result, Meaningful Volunteer will only employ local staff and pay them 200% of market rate. Local folk must also invest in some way to the projects they are participants in. Nothing in Meaningful Volunteer is free! An investment in a project means a project is much more likely to succeed. Sustainable Solutions: Any income generating projects that Meaningful Volunteer engages in must be self-sustaining. Meaningful Volunteer may provide some start-up capital, but the project must self-sustain without financial input from additional financial input. All projects must submit budgets and a business plan as a minimum. Corruption: Corruption is a large problem in developing communities.
